Don’t worry. You’re not alone in your questions about marketing. Have you registered for an Infusionsoft User Group yet? If you haven't, you're passing up a very useful resource - other small business owners and Infusionsoft users like YOU.

It’s your chance to meet with other Infusionsoft users in your area to discuss the software suite and to share tactics and strategies. Here you can gather new ideas and learn useful tips. Have a perplexing problem about how to market your latest product or whether to invest more of your time on Twitter or Facebook? Chances are someone else in the group may have faced a similar problem. So ask a question and find answers.

You don’t have all day to devote to marketing, so you need to take what time you have and make it count. Find out about the personal touches others share with their clients in their marketing. Sharpen your campaigns to a razor’s edge and discover important timesavers to make your next campaign go a little smoother.

User group meetings allow you to learn about a multitude of subjects, from networking to driving more customers to your website. These meetings also allow you to give your feedback on others’ products or to receive their comments about yours. And it’s not just about the knowledge you can gain. It’s also a chance to share your experiences and maybe help someone else through a challenge you’ve successfully overcome.

There are Infusionsoft user groups practically everywhere. They meet once a month and they will typically email you reminders. In addition to idea exchanges and learning about best practices, meetings sometimes include guest experts and hands-on demonstrations. If you live in New England, you’re invited to join us. The group we facilitate meets at Tatnuck Bookseller in Westborough, Massachusetts.
